Former President Donald Trump wasted no time blasting back at former congresswoman Liz Cheney after the lifelong Wyoming Republican campaigned for Vice President Kamala Harris this week.

“Liz Cheney is a stupid war hawk,” Trump told Fox News on Thursday, just hours after Cheney and Harris stood side by side at a campaign stop in Wisconsin. “All she wants to do is shoot missiles at people.”

The shocking sight of Cheney endorsing Harris in a small Midwestern city known as the birthplace of the Republican party continued to roil Trump supporters both near and far from Wyoming on Friday with dissenters online digging up old tweets and comments of Cheney’s criticizing Harris.

Meanwhile, U.S. Rep. Harriet Hageman, Cheney’s replacement in Congress, said the act showed that her predecessor had no “North Star.”

Trump predicted that the unexpected alliance between Cheney and Harris will turn out unfavorably for both women in the long run.

Cheney had joined Harris at a campaign event in Ripon, Wisconsin, where she told the audience to “reject the depraved cruelty of Donald Trump” and endorsed his Democratic opponent.

“I was a Republican even before Donald Trump started spray-tanning,” Cheney said early in her speech. She criticized Trump for inciting the Jan. 6 Capitol Riot and said he “is not fit to lead” the country.

“What Jan. 6 shows us is that there is not an ounce of compassion in Donald Trump,” Cheney said. “He is petty, he is vindictive and he is cruel.”

In response, the former president also ripped Cheney and her father, former Vice President Dick Cheney, on his social media platform Truth Social that same day.

He described Dick Cheney as the “leader of our ridiculous journey into the Middle East, where Trillions of Dollars were spent, millions of people were killed — and for what? NOTHING!

“Today, these two fools, because the Republican Party no longer wants them, endorsed the most Liberal Senator in the U.S. Senate, further Left than even Pocahontas or Crazy Bernie Sanders - Lyin’ Kamala Harris,” Trump wrote. “What a pathetic couple that is, both suffering gravely from Trump Derangement Syndrome. Good Luck to them both!!!”

Trump’s claim has at least some validity as the Wyoming Republican Party declined to censure both at its meeting last month because it no longer views the Cheneys as Wyoming Republicans

Trump’s long-held animosity toward Cheney stems from her vocal criticism of his attempts to overturn the 2020 presidential election, her vote to impeach him and her role as vice chair of the United States Select Committee on the Jan. 6 Attack.

Wyoming ‘Really Smart’

Trump also pointed out in his post that Cheney lost her reelection bid in 2022 to his endorsed candidate U.S. Rep. Harriet Hageman by 38 percentage points, a result Trump commended, calling Wyoming voters “really smart.” He also claimed it was the largest loss for a sitting representative in the history of Congress but that’s not true. It was the third largest loss in the last 46 years.

Hageman told Cowboy State Daily on Thursday she's not surprised about Cheney campaigning for Harris.

“What people are seeing today is exactly why the people of Wyoming fired Liz Cheney as their Congresswoman," Hageman said. "Four years ago she correctly said that Kamala Harris was dangerously liberal, but today she is campaigning for her. She has no core values, no North Star, and she is supporting a candidate that no conservative would ever join up with. Maybe they can share memories on all of the forever wars they’ve both gotten America into.”

Poking The Hornet’s Nest

Less than a month before the November election, Democrats across the nation have increasingly invested in reaching across party lines to target Republican voters less than enthusiastic with Trump’s campaign and other candidates like him.

Many Republicans have criticized Cheney for this move and have speculated that she’s angling for a cabinet position in Harris’ office should she win the presidency.

Some on the left like the Council on American-Islamic Relations (CAIR) have also expressed disgust about Harris’ support for Cheney.

“No elected official who cares about justice or the rule of law or human rights should ever praise Liz Cheney, a torture advocate, anti-Muslim bigot and warmonger who once refused to condemn racists spreading the Obama birther conspiracy,” said CAIR National Deputy Director Edward Ahmed Mitchell in a Friday statement. “Supporting Trump’s impeachment does not wash away Rep. Cheney’s support for crimes like torture.”

Cheney has bridged much of her support for Harris around preventing Trump from getting in the Oval Office, but also praised the vice president for “working to unite reasonable people all across the political spectrum.”

It remains to be seen if the Republican endorsements for Harris will pay off in the election.

On Friday, Harris released a new ad featuring Cheney that will play in battleground states, according to The New York Times. The ad puts a focus on Republicans like Cheney who have announced their support for Harris.

In the ad, the Times reports that Cheney issues her support for Harris and says America is “standing at the breach in a critical moment in our nation’s history. We have a shared commitment as Americans to do what’s right for this country.”
